Top 50 Latest Blockchain Platforms Statistics, Data & Trends in 2025

  1. Blockchain Market Size in 2025: The blockchain market is expected to experience significant growth, expanding from $28.93 billion in 2024 to $49.18 billion in 2025,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 70.0%, as more industries integrate blockchain solutions into their operations.
  2. Projected Blockchain Market Size by 2032: By 2032, the blockchain market is anticipated to reach a substantial value of at least $12,895 billion, driven by an annual growth rate of 68%, which underscores the technology’s potential for widespread adoption across various sectors.
  3. Blockchain Technology Spending in 2024: In 2024, blockchain-related technology spending is projected to surpass $19 billion, highlighting the increasing investment in blockchain infrastructure and solutions by businesses seeking to leverage its benefits.
  4. Number of Cryptocurrency Wallets by 2032: The number of cryptocurrency wallets is expected to grow significantly, reaching approximately 170 million by 2032, as more users become involved in digital currencies and blockchain-based financial services.
  5. Bitcoin Block Explorer Users in March 2023: As of March 2023, there were approximately 85 million users worldwide utilizing Bitcoin block explorers, which are tools that allow users to track and verify transactions on the Bitcoin blockchain.
  6. Daily Bitcoin Transactions in March 2023: During March 2023, the Bitcoin network processed an average of about 336,600 transactions per day, demonstrating its capacity for handling a substantial volume of financial transactions.
  7. Percentage of the World’s Population with Bitcoin: Currently, one-quarter of the world’s population has some level of involvement with Bitcoin, whether through ownership or usage, indicating its widespread recognition and adoption.
  8. Percentage of Americans Investing in Crypto: As of recent surveys, approximately 16% of Americans have invested in cryptocurrencies, reflecting a growing interest in digital assets among the U.S. population.
  9. Potential Cost Savings for Financial Institutions: The integration of blockchain technology could lead to significant cost savings for financial institutions, potentially reducing their costs by up to $11.2 billion annually through increased efficiency and reduced intermediaries.
  10. Blockchain in Healthcare by 2023: By 2023, the blockchain market in the healthcare sector was predicted to be worth $231 million, with a potential comp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 63% over six years, driven by its applications in secure data management and supply chain tracking.
  11. Blockchain in Healthcare by 2025: The blockchain market in healthcare is expected to expand further, reaching a value of $5.61 billion by 2025, as more healthcare providers adopt blockchain solutions to enhance data security and interoperability.
  12. Global Trade Processing Costs Reduction: The adoption of blockchain technology for transferring securities could result in a reduction of global trade processing costs by between $17 billion and $24 billion annually, primarily through increased efficiency and reduced settlement times.
  13. CAGR of Blockchain Technology Market (2022-2030): The worldwide blockchain technology market is expected to expand at an impressive comp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 85.9% from 2022 to 2030, driven by its increasing adoption across multiple industries.
  14. Global Blockchain Market Value in 2026: By 2026, the global blockchain market is projected to be worth approximately $67.4 billion, reflecting its growing role in transforming business operations and financial systems.
  15. Blockchain Market Value Distribution by Sector: The banking sector currently holds the largest share of the blockchain market value, as financial institutions are among the earliest adopters of blockchain technology for enhancing security and efficiency.
  16. Blockchain Use in International Payments: Blockchain technology is primarily used for international payments and settlements, offering faster and more secure cross-border transactions compared to traditional methods.
  17. Blockchain’s Impact on GDP by 2030: By 2030, blockchain technology is anticipated to contribute significantly to the global economy, potentially boosting the world’s GDP by $1.76 trillion through increased efficiency and innovation.
  18. Potential Earnings for Banking Industry from Blockchain: The banking industry could generate over $1 billion in earnings from blockchain-based cryptocurrencies and related financial services, as these technologies become more integrated into mainstream banking operations.
  19. Number of Ethereum in Circulation (March 2023): As of March 2023, there were approximately 120.45 million Ethereum (ETH) in circulation, making it one of the most widely held cryptocurrencies after Bitcoin.
  20. Ethereum Transactions per Day (March 2023): During March 2023, the Ethereum blockchain processed about 1.043 million transactions per day, highlighting its capacity for handling a large volume of decentralized applications and financial transactions.
  21. Active Ethereum Addresses (March 2023): In March 2023, there were approximately 413,904 active Ethereum addresses, indicating a strong user base engaged in various activities on the Ethereum network.
  22. Ethereum’s Share of the DeFi Market: Ethereum controls a significant portion of the decentralized finance (DeFi) market, with approximately 63.4% of DeFi applications and protocols built on its platform.
  23. Number of Decentralized Programs (DApps) on Ethereum: There are over 3,000 decentralized applications (DApps) on the Ethereum network, ranging from gaming and finance to social media and prediction markets.
  24. Types of Blockchain Networks: Blockchain networks can be categorized into four major types: Private, Public, Hybrid, and Consortium, each serving different purposes and offering varying levels of access and security.
  25. Blockchain Market Growth Rate (2024-2025): The blockchain market is expected to grow at a remarkable comp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 70.0% from 2024 to 2025, driven by increased adoption and innovation in blockchain technology.
  26. Blockchain Market Size in 2029: By 2029, the blockchain market is projected to reach $216.82 billion,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 44.9%, reflecting sustained growth and expansion into new sectors.
  27. Number of Companies in the UK’s Blockchain Sector (September 2024): As of September 2024, there were 546 active and dormant companies operating in the UK’s blockchain sector, highlighting the country’s vibrant ecosystem for blockchain innovation.
  28. Stage of Companies in the UK’s Blockchain Sector: Among these companies, 60.4% were in the seed stage, 20.6% in the venture stage, and 3.0% in the growth stage, indicating a strong pipeline of startups and early-stage ventures.
  29. Focus of Companies in the UK’s Blockchain Sector: The majority of these companies, at 86.8%, focused on creating application software, while 33.7% were engaged in fintech, reflecting the sector’s emphasis on developing practical blockchain solutions.
  30. Percentage of Fortune 500 Companies Using Blockchain (2025): By 2025, it is anticipated that over 80% of Fortune 500 companies will have integrated blockchain solutions into their operations, demonstrating the technology’s widespread adoption among major corporations.
  31. Total Value Locked (TVL) in DeFi Protocols (January 2024): As of January 2024, the total value locked (TVL) in decentralized finance (DeFi) protocols surpassed $200 billion, highlighting the significant financial activity and investment in DeFi applications.
  32. Global Executives’ View on Blockchain (2025): In 2025, 77% of global executives believe that blockchain will be a disruptive force in their industry within the next five years, indicating a high level of confidence in its transformative potential.
  33. Number of Bitcoin ATMs in the United States: The United States has the most crypto ATMs, with 14,112 ATMs, accounting for 83.2% of the global market, reflecting the country’s strong infrastructure for cryptocurrency access.
  34. Number of Bitcoin ATMs in Europe: Europe ranks second with 1,258 ATMs, accounting for 7.4% of the global market, as European countries also see a growing demand for cryptocurrency services.
  35. Number of Bitcoin ATMs in Canada: Canada ranks third with 1,246 ATMs, accounting for 7.3% of the global market, demonstrating Canada’s active role in the cryptocurrency ecosystem.
  36. Number of Blockchain Wallets by the End of 2020: By the end of 2020, there were 63 million distinct Blockchain.com wallets, marking a significant milestone in user adoption and engagement with blockchain-based financial services.
  37. Growth Rate of Blockchain Wallets: The number of blockchain wallets has been continuously expanding since 2015, reflecting the increasing popularity of cryptocurrencies and blockchain technology.
  38. Market Capitalization of Major Cryptocurrencies (2020): In 2020, Bitcoin dominated the market with 66% of the total market valuation, followed by Ether (8%), and Ripple (4%), while other cryptocurrencies like Litecoin and Monero held smaller shares.
  39. Market Capitalization of Other Cryptocurrencies (2020): Litecoin had a market capitalization of 1%, and Monero had 0.5%, with other cryptocurrencies combining for 7% of the total market capitalization in 2020.
  40. Trading Volume of Major Cryptocurrency Exchanges (2023): In 2023, major cryptocurrency exchanges such as Binance ($28.85 billion), HBTC ($14.44 billion), and Hydax Exchange ($12.19 billion) were among the largest in terms of trading volume, highlighting their role in facilitating global cryptocurrency transactions.
  41. Number of Active Companies in Blockchain Sector (UK, September 2024): As of September 2024, 60.4% of the companies in the UK’s blockchain sector were in the seed stage, indicating a strong pipeline of new startups and early-stage ventures in the industry.
  42. Blockchain Technology Spending Growth: Blockchain spending is projected to hit $19 billion by 2024, reflecting significant growth from previous years as businesses increasingly invest in blockchain infrastructure and solutions.
  43. Blockchain Market Segmentation: The blockchain market is segmented by type (Private, Public, Hybrid), provider (Application, Middleware, Infrastructure), and application (BFSI, Telecom & IT, Government), highlighting its diverse range of uses and technologies.
  44. Private Blockchain Types: Private blockchains include Permissioned Blockchain and Consortium Blockchain, both of which restrict access to authorized parties, offering enhanced security and control.
  45. Public Blockchain Types: Public blockchains, such as Permissionless Blockchain and Open Source Blockchain, allow anyone to join and participate, providing transparency and decentralization.
  46. Hybrid Blockchain Features: Hybrid blockchains combine elements of Private and Public blockchains, focusing on interoperability solutions that allow for both secure data management and open access.
  47. AI and Blockchain Market Projection (2025): The integ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and blockchain is projected to exceed $703 million in 2025, as these technologies are increasingly combined to enhance efficiency and decision-making in various sectors.
  48. Tokenization of Real-World Assets by 2030: By 2030, the tokenization of real-world assets is projected to reach $600 billion, reflecting the growing trend of converting physical assets into digital tokens for easier trading and management.
  49. Number of Banks Issuing Tokenized Assets in 2025: The number of banks issuing tokenized assets is expected to double in 2025, as financial institutions increasingly explore blockchain-based solutions for asset management and trading.
  50. New Tax Reporting Standards for Crypto (2025): From 2025, new Treasury regulations will require centralized crypto exchanges and brokers to report transactions using Form 1099-DA, marking a significant step towards regulatory clarity in the cryptocurrency sector.
